Web27 sep. 2024 · Preheat oven to 450º. Set up a "simulated baker’s oven" by placing a baking stone on the center rack, with a metal broiler pan on the rack beneath, at least 4 inches away from the baking stone to prevent the stone from cracking. Web17 nov. 2024 · preheat the oven to 450˚ WITH the dutch oven inside. when the dough has risen you can lightly sprinkle with a bit of flour if you want to and slash it lightly with a razor. remove the dutch oven from the oven, set the top aside, it will be hot. grab the edges of the paper or foil and set the dough in the hot dutch oven.
